Python视角解析ASP:安全防御与对象精要
|
AI模拟效果图,仅供参考 作为开源站长,我们深知Python在现代Web开发中的重要性,而ASP(Active Server Pages)作为一种经典的服务器端技术,虽然逐渐被更现代化的框架所取代,但其核心思想和安全机制仍然值得深入研究。从Python的角度来看,ASP的核心在于动态生成网页内容,这与Python中Django或Flask等框架的功能有异曲同工之妙。然而,ASP的执行环境和语法结构与Python差异较大,理解其工作原理有助于我们在实际开发中更好地进行跨平台兼容与安全防护。 在安全防御方面,ASP常见的漏洞包括SQL注入、跨站脚本(XSS)和文件包含问题。Python开发者在处理类似问题时,通常依赖于ORM工具和模板引擎来防止这些攻击,而在ASP中,开发者需要手动进行输入验证和输出编码,这要求更高的警惕性和代码规范。 对象精要方面,ASP中的对象模型(如Request、Response、Server、Session等)为开发者提供了丰富的功能接口。Python中虽然没有完全相同的对象体系,但通过类和模块的设计,同样可以实现类似的封装与复用,提升代码的可维护性。 对于开源站长而言,学习ASP的安全机制和对象设计,不仅有助于理解传统Web开发的演变,还能帮助我们在构建现代系统时借鉴其优点,规避常见陷阱。同时,结合Python的优势,可以更高效地实现安全可靠的Web服务。 站长个人见解,无论是ASP还是Python,安全始终是Web开发的核心关注点。通过不断学习和实践,我们可以更好地应对各种挑战,打造更加稳固的网络环境。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

